Anyone wanting a third shot (AstraZeneca) can now get it at Preah Ang Duong Hospital. It must be four months since your second dose otherwise they won't do it.

Starts at 7am and they do 200 shots, and then again at 2pm, another 200. Take a number at the desk at the entry on Norodom opposite CIMB Bank, and head up the ramps to E2.

They're also doing first/second doses (Sinovac) on the ground floor if you haven't had these yet.

Limited supplies of AZ left so get in quick if you want it. Take your vaccination card and passport.
